    The value of y vaires directly with x mean:
y and x always have the same ratio k.
k = y / x
In ths case:
k = y / x = 18 / 12 = 6 ∙ 3 / 6 ∙ 2 = 3 / 2 = 1.5
k = y / x
y = k x
When x = 60
y = 1.5 ∙ 60 = 90

    " y varies directly with x" -----> y = kx, k is a constant
given: y=18 when x=12
18 = 12k
k = 3/2
so you have y = (3/2)x
when x = 60 , y = (3/2)(60) = 90
